커뮤니티

수식 검토 부탁드립니다

프로필 이미지
퍼담아유
2017-08-30 19:27:25
133
글번호 112371
답변완료
선물 분봉에 사용 목적으로 아래를 작성해보았는데 수식 검토 부탁드립니다 회신은 e-mail. mintaizhi@gmail.com으로 가능할까요? ======================================================================================== Inputs: ShortPeriod(2), Period1(13), qty(2); var1 = ema(C,Period1); "13지수이평" Variables: Fval(0),FvalFast(0); Fval = ((Close - Close[1]) * Volume) ; "2 Force Index" FvalFast = Ema(Fval, ShortPeriod); if ema(C,13)<C[1]) and ema(Fval, ShortPeriod)<0 Then Buy("매수", ? ,qty); "만일 직전종가가 13지수이평보다 크고 2Force Index가 0보다 작으면, 다음봉 현재가가 13지수이평과 만날때 매수" if ema(C,13)>C[1]) and ema(Fval, ShortPeriod)>0 Then Sell("매도", ? ,qty); "만일 직전종가가 13지수이평보다 작고 2Force Index가 0보다 크면, 다음봉 현재가가 13지수이평과 만날때 매도" ======================================================================================== 시스템에 복사해서 사용할 예정입니다 감사합니다
사용자 함수
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2017-08-31 11:21:22

안녕하세요 예스스탁입니다. 1 현재 미완성봉에서 현재가와 지수이평값을 비교해 신호를 발생하는 것은 체계상 불가능합니다. 가능한 방법이라면 직전봉(최근완성봉)의 지수이평값과 미완성봉의 현재가를 비교해 신호를 발생하는 방법뿐이 없습니다. Inputs: ShortPeriod(2), Period1(13), qty(2); Variables: Fval(0),FvalFast(0); var1 = ema(C,Period1); Fval = ((Close - Close[1]) * Volume); FvalFast = Ema(Fval, ShortPeriod); #봉완성시 종가가 지수이평보다 크고 forceindex는 0보다 작으면 #지수이평값을 셋팅하고 다음봉에서 셋팅된 값보다 같거나 낮은 시세가 발생하면 매수진입 if var1 < C and FvalFast < 0 Then Buy("매수",atlimit,var1,qty); #봉완성시 종가가 지수이평보다 작고 forceindex는 0보다 크면 #지수이평값을 셋팅하고 다음봉에서 셋팅된 값보다 같거나 큰 시세가 발생하면 매도진입 if var1 > C and FvalFast > 0 Then Sell("매도",atlimit,var1,qty); 2 수식 답변은 메일로 답변드리지 않습니다. 게시판을 통해서만 답변드립니다. 즐거운 하루되세요 > 퍼담아유 님이 쓴 글입니다. > 제목 : 수식 검토 부탁드립니다 > 선물 분봉에 사용 목적으로 아래를 작성해보았는데 수식 검토 부탁드립니다 회신은 e-mail. mintaizhi@gmail.com으로 가능할까요? ======================================================================================== Inputs: ShortPeriod(2), Period1(13), qty(2); var1 = ema(C,Period1); "13지수이평" Variables: Fval(0),FvalFast(0); Fval = ((Close - Close[1]) * Volume) ; "2 Force Index" FvalFast = Ema(Fval, ShortPeriod); if ema(C,13)<C[1]) and ema(Fval, ShortPeriod)<0 Then Buy("매수", ? ,qty); "만일 직전종가가 13지수이평보다 크고 2Force Index가 0보다 작으면, 다음봉 현재가가 13지수이평과 만날때 매수" if ema(C,13)>C[1]) and ema(Fval, ShortPeriod)>0 Then Sell("매도", ? ,qty); "만일 직전종가가 13지수이평보다 작고 2Force Index가 0보다 크면, 다음봉 현재가가 13지수이평과 만날때 매도" ======================================================================================== 시스템에 복사해서 사용할 예정입니다 감사합니다